Binfield Badger Group
EnvironmentThe group aims to improve the protection of badgers across Berkshire by promoting awareness via newsletters, regular meetings, attendance at local events and giving talks in Berkshire and the surrounding area. The Group also monitors badger activity at a number of setts across Berkshire and liaises with Councils on any proposals which may have an impact on badgers and their habitat.

Lincolnshire Naturalists' Union
Arts, Environment, HeritagePromote the thorough investigation of the geology, fauna, flora & physical features of the County: bring together the interest in & study of every branch of natural history; hold & maintain library, records & reference material. Major activities:- Programme of Spring & Summer Field Meetings; Programme of Winter indoor meetings culminating with annual Recorders Meeting; Publication of Transactions.

Powys Species-Habitat Association
EnvironmentWe monitor barn owl and bat nesting sites and where necessary provide nesting boxes or partial renovation of buildings to protect the nest.We also provide illustrated talks and field walks to educate the public.2014-2015 we received a Heritage Lottery Fund grant to enable us to put cameras in all our boxes in order to monitor barn owls with the least disturbance. West Surrey Badger Group
Education, EnvironmentOperate a rescue and rehabilitation operation for injured & sick badgers. Advise individuals and organisations on issues of badgers, their habitat and the law. Inform the public about the badger and its habitat through meetings, workshops and school visits.
Biographical Arboretum, Little Mesopotamia CIO
EnvironmentSince 2002 over 5000 trees have been planted in Beckermet Cumbria on farm land which has been named Little Mesopotamia as it lies on a site between two tributaries of the river Ehen. The charity aims to nurture and care for an experimental botanical collection,to protect the natural environment for the benefit of wildlife, and to encourage understanding of conservation issues with guided tours.
